http://www.unlockme.co.uk/dct4free.html This wont get rid of AT&T Wireless settings on the phone, like for web browsing, etc. You can go and get your phone "flexed" (I think that's the term) to a generic firmware for $25 or so which will get rid of all of the AT&T Wireless stuff on the phone. another easy way is to call up att and tell them that you are goin to say london over the weekend and need the unlock code on the phone, they will send you the info within a week... and then your phone is unlocked for good.

For those who don't know - T-Mobile gives you the unlock code (if you ask) 14 days after you begin one of their plans.
